Importance of Good Characterization, and How You Can Do It

One important part of writing that often doesn't get enough credit is the creation of good characters. When writing a story, people highlight the importance of a good plot, but in reality, many books are carried by their characters. It can often be hard to describe the pleasure that a book with good characters can provide, because their is rarely one thing that is catching about the story. Instead, it's simply the way the character makes you feel, the way you are able to relate to them.

Identifying Characterization

Working on characterization, I think the best way to get started is to analyze characterization in stories you read. This is a great activity for students, but it can also be a fun activity for aspiring writers. As you read a book, make note of the ways you would describe the characters. As you write words, make note of how you know these things. How do you know that the character is tall or fair skinned? What makes you think the character is funny or selfish? By making note of how the author is able to convey characterization, you can do it better yourself.

Once you've seen how authors do it, you can start to practice building your own character.s Build out a sheet that recognizes the attributes you'd like your character to have. When you build a character bio, not only will you have the history of that person, but you will also have the way they act. and the expectations a reader might have of them. Now, when you plot out scenes, you can keep these characteristics in mind and also plot out the way the reader will find out new information about the character and his or her personality in that chapter.

Implementing Effective Characterization

When trying to bring characterization into your own work, it is important to identify the ways in which you can use characterization. One way you can show your characters is through explicit information. This method is often best used for details that you can't "show" the reader. Things like physical attributes, or the character's name, must be provided directly. When you do it is up to you, though it's important to recognize that you don't want to barrage the reader with too much information at once or they might miss the information or fail to absorb it all.

However, for most characterization, explicitly telling the reader can be sloppy and will often give away your limited writing skills. Instead, it is better to highlight the character's attitudes and personality through their actions and past experiences. Flashbacks can be an effective way to show a character's personality as you will see what the character has gone through and the decisions they made in their past. Another effective method is to have the character interact with different people, and show how they handle those interactions. Placing the character around friends and enemies will help the reader see what kind of person the character is, and how they act.

Overall, this is just a basic template to start your work crafting new characters. The most important step in developing your characterization skills is awareness. Recognize as you read other books what makes you view a character in a certain way, and keep these interpretations in mind when writing your own book. By learning to build effective characters, you will position yourself better to build a following, as readers will be eager to see what happens next to their favorite characters.
